CONFINES: new EP "Work Up the Blood" now streaming 

Confines' new EP, Work Up the Blood, is now streaming in its entirety via Metal Injection.

Thumping NYC industrial-techno anthems, Confines is the solo project of David Castillo — co-owner of Brooklyn’s Saint Vitus Bar, co-founder of Faktor Music, and vocalist of Primitive Weapons.

The sound is a mix of banging rhythms and heavy ambience, referencing the likes of Nitzer Ebb, Depeche Mode, Vatican Shadow, and the Colombian cumbia music that played in Castillo's childhood home. Taking the music to an even higher and more universal level is Castillo’s impassioned vocal approach – soulful screams and murmurous melodies reflecting his years embedded in the hardcore punk and metal scenes.

Confines is Castillo's most personal project to date and Work Up the Blood is its ultimate representation so far. In Confines, Castillo has created a space where he can exorcise his own demons while also selflessly providing a thumping, cathartic soundtrack by which for others to find their release.

Metal Injection states: "The EP will absolutely tear your head off with its foundation-shaking bass.”

Work Up the Blood officially drops December 3rd via Synthicide, the label owned by acclaimed author/DJ/promoter Andi Harriman.
